Technological Innovations in Gambling

The gambling industry is poised for a significant transformation driven by rapid technological advancements, including new options such as online casinos that enhance accessibility. Innovations such as vir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) are creating immersive gaming experiences that transport players to virtual casinos or racetracks. These technologies allow gamblers to engage with their surroundings in a more interactive way, enhancing the thrill of the game.

Moreover, the integration of artificial intelligence (AI) is streamlining operations and personalizing experiences. AI algorithms analyze player behavior, preferences, and trends, allowing casinos to tailor offerings and improve customer satisfaction. This personalized approach not only attracts new players but also fosters loyalty among existing customers.

The Rise of Mobile Gaming

As smartphones become increasingly ubiquitous, mobile gaming is rapidly gaining traction within the gambling landscape. Players appreciate the convenience of placing bets or playing games from their mobile devices, which has led to a surge in mobile gambling applications. These platforms are designed with user-friendly interfaces and optimized for various devices, enhancing accessibility for all types of players.

The rise of mobile gaming is also prompting casinos to invest in mobile-friendly technologies, ensuring that they remain competitive. With secure payment methods and advanced encryption, mobile gambling is becoming safer and more reliable, enticing players to engage with their favorite games on the go.

Regulatory Changes and Legalization

Regulatory changes are shaping the future of gambling, as governments around the world reconsider their stances on gambling laws. The trend toward legalization is gaining momentum, with more regions recognizing the economic benefits of regulated gambling markets. This shift is expected to lead to increased competition, ultimately benefiting consumers through better offerings and enhanced protection.

Additionally, with the rise of online and mobile gambling, regulatory bodies are developing new frameworks to ensure fair play and responsible gambling practices. These regulations will likely evolve in response to emerging technologies and market trends, further influencing the gambling landscape in the coming years.

Social Gambling and Community Engagement

Social gambling is another trend gaining popularity, where players engage with friends and family in online gambling experiences. This shift emphasizes the communal aspect of gambling, encouraging social interaction through multiplayer games and shared experiences. Social platforms are integrating gambling features, making it easy for players to join games and share outcomes.

Furthermore, community engagement is driving the development of peer-to-peer betting platforms. These platforms allow players to set their own odds and compete against one another, fostering a sense of camaraderie and competition. As social elements become more integral to gambling experiences, the industry will continue to adapt to meet these changing consumer demands.
